#709094 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#709094 is composed of 43.9% red, 56.5% green and 58%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 24.3% cyan, 2.7% magenta, 0% yellow and 42% black. It has a hue angle of 186.7 degrees, a saturation of 14.4% and a lightness of 51%. #709094 color hex could be obtained by blending #e0ffff with #002129. Closest websafe color is: #669999.

● #709094 color description : Dark grayish cyan.
#709094 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#709094 has RGB values of R:112, G:144, B:148 and CMYK values of C:0.24, M:0.03, Y:0, K:0.42. Its decimal value is 7377044.
